The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) has urged the Inspector General to apprehend the assailants of the Nigerian IT prodigy and bring them to book. David Ntekim Rex, a Nigerian IT sensation, fatally shot in Lagos by robbers later died on Monday. A press release signed by Kola Ologbondiyan, PDP National Publicity Secretary said ”PDP further called for an inquest into the role played by the police in the killing of the 22-year-old by suspected armed robbers in Jibowu, Lagos. A total of 164 persons are officially confirmed to have been infected by COVID-19 in Akwa Ibom State in one week, according to Nigeria Centre for Disease Control. A report conducted by Straightnews shows that 52 persons were infected on January 17; 35 on January 15 while 34 were reported on January 14 contained in official Twitter of NCDC. Also, NCDC said seven persons were infected on January 12; while 36 were confirmed on January 10. Nigeria witnessed COVID-19 14 deaths on Monday, bringing the total number of deaths to 1,449 recorded in 36 states and the Federal Capital Territory. This is as Nigeria recorded 1,617 new confirmed cases, bringing the overall to 11,2004 cases in the country. Already, 89,939 persons have been discharged, according to Nigeria Centre for Disease Control (NCDC). An Ekiti High Court, Monday, sentenced an Assistant Commissioner of Police and his mechanic to life imprisonment for buying a stolen vehicle from kidnap suspects. The court also sentenced seven other persons, Solomon Ayodele Obamoyegun, 39, Femi Omiawe, 40, Damilola Obamoyegun, 20, Bose Sade Ajayi, 30, George Lucky, 35, Chukwuma Nnamani, 22, and Sunday Ogunleye 45 to five years imprisonment each without an option of fine for kidnapping. Lionel Messi was sent off for the first time playing for Barcelona as Athletic Bilbao stunned the Catalans to win the Spanish Super Cup on Sunday, a dramatic final finishing 3-2 after extra-time. Moments before Bilbao’s momentous triumph was confirmed, Messi threw an arm at Asier Villalibre, who had earlier scored a 90th-minute equaliser in normal time to deny Barca victory. Antoine Griezmann’s double looked to have sealed the trophy but Villalibre intervened before Inaki Williams’ fabulous strike three minutes into extra time proved decisive.
